Keeping an Aquarium of Freshwater or Saltwater fish can be a wonderful relaxing hobby. There are so many different kinds of fish that can be kept. Their are so many beautiful, and not so beautiful fish, that are available. Well designed and maintained aquariums are beautiful and easy to care for. Along with their beauty they have a relaxing affect on your home. There are lots of Online Resources for help with keeping an aquarium. I have included some of them here on this page.
